Statement of the Job
As a Data Analytics and Reporting Specialist, candidate will translate business reporting needs into a modern, scalable analytics and reporting ecosystem.
You will design and deliver reports and dashboards using Power BI and Oracle Analytics Cloud (OAC), supported by well-governed data models, curated datasets, and reliable integration pipelines.
Candidate will integrate data from multiple sources, implement transformations, and ensure consistent performance, governance, and observability across the reporting platforms.
This role is ideal for a hands-on analytics developer with strong SQL and data warehousing skills, experience building semantic models for self-service analytics, and working knowledge of Azure data services, Power BI and the Oracle/OCI ecosystem.
Beyond the technical stack, we are looking for someone who enjoys the detective work of discovery, someone who can sit down with the business, ask the right questions, to understand the actual need.
Responsibilities to include but not limited to:
Partner with business owners to clarify reporting needs, define success criteria, and translate requirements into metrics, dashboards, and reports.
Serve as a SME for data analytics, ensuring business team goals are addressed efficiently. Regularly monitor user feedback and adjust tools as needed. Create easy-to-follow guides explaining data sources and meaning for all employees.
Conduct an analysis of existing application databases and data warehouses to identify relevant data sources for reporting purposes.
Design, build, and maintain Power BI and OAC dashboards and reports, including drilldowns, filters, and KPI scorecards.
Develop and optimize data models/semantic layers and curated datasets to enable self-service analytics.
Build and operate automated, scalable data pipelines and integrations; implement validation checks and documentation.
Ensure governance and reliability: metadata consistency, lineage, access controls, and environment management.
Monitor and optimize query/report performance; troubleshoot data issues end-to-end (source to dashboard).
Enable repeatable deployments by using Git and CI/CD practices (Azure DevOps and/or GitLab) where applicable.
Own assigned deliverables end-to-end and communicate status, risks, and timelines.
